Embakasi East Member of Parliament Babu Owino’s opponent has moved to the Supreme Court to challenge a decision of the appeal court upholding the election victory of Mr. Owino.
Though the reports emerged today, Francis Mureithi told Pulselive.co.ke that he filed the petition at the apex court about a month ago.
He wants the decision of the Court of Appeal overturned insisting that the election of Owino was not free and fair.
Mr Mureithi divulged that the case will be heard on August 13, 2018.
